[6].Standards-based grading (SBG) is a specific alternative grading strategy that awards gradesbased on how many learning objectives (or standards) have been met. SBG has beenimplemented in a variety of engineering courses including Signals and Systems [7], Circuits [8],Fluid Mechanics [9], Thermodynamics [10,11], and Engineering Design [12]. SBG meets thefour pillars of alternative grading by identifying a clear list of standards, providing feedback tostudents that communicates if they have met each standard or not, assigning a grade based on thenumber of standards met, and allowing students to continue to reattempt to meet each standard –rather than just getting a low grade and moving on without learning the topic [13].Previous work has

Anomalies, such as a lack of positive response from the current methods, can serve ascatalysts for dissatisfaction, rendering the current approach less meaningful. • intelligibility Once there is dissatisfaction, one of the necessary conditions for a new strategy to beaccepted is its intelligibility. Intelligibility refers both to understanding the structure of thestrategy and its conduct, also the evaluation mechanisms and the learning concepts that underliethe strategy. • plausibility The new strategy should align with the teacher's knowledges, including beliefs,epistemological commitments, other theories or knowledge, and previous experiences.
